A school-aged child is admitted to the hospital with a vaso-occlusive sickle cell crisis. Which measure in the child's care plan should be given priority?
Encouraging the child to take deep breaths hourly
Maintaining fluids through an intravenous line
Beginning active range-of-motion exercises
Seeing that the child ingests a protein-rich diet
The Correct Answer is B
A. Encouraging deep breathing is important for preventing pulmonary complications but is not the priority in managing a vaso-occlusive crisis.
B. Maintaining hydration through intravenous fluids is the priority as it helps to reduce blood viscosity and prevent further sickling of cells, which is critical in managing a vaso-occlusive crisis.
C. Active range-of-motion exercises are important but are not a priority during an acute vaso-occlusive crisis.
D. A protein-rich diet supports overall health but is not immediately relevant to the acute management of a vaso-occlusive crisis.
